Output e7f993e7dda3c70b0f97f23e4e739551ee770be703e096979625d7ad1a2f7143:5

value
73832654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58cd617cfc9c2261fd3fccabab43ef0f5bc5118 OP_EQUAL
address
MUpugqWDRQq45rJeNrwQg5a15HnBrhHuUf
transaction
e7f993e7dda3c70b0f97f23e4e739551ee770be703e096979625d7ad1a2f7143
spent
true